On Tue 01-09-26 14:14:37, Christian Brauner wrote:
> Convert to const struct mnt_idmap.
>
> A mount's idmapping is immutable. The only thing that is allowed to be
> modified afterwards is the reference count and that is hidden behind
> mnt_idmap_get() and mnt_idmap_put(). Everything else only ever reads
> from the idmapping. This is the same model that struct cred uses and the
> idmapping is also rather sensitive.
>
> So make the idmap argument const wherever we can. The conversion is done
> from the bottom up so callers can continue to pass a non-const pointer
> to a const parameter until the conversion is finished.
>
> No functional changes.
